About Fit By Design

Fit By Design is a fitness business that offers functional integrative training, led by a team that includes Kris and Nicole. The trainers are dedicated to the health and well-being of each client, providing personalized care and attention. The results of their training programs are evident in the success stories of their clients. One client has gone from being sedentary for five years to mountain biking after a year and a half of training. Another client has lost over 9 inches, 10 dress sizes, and 100 lbs in a year of training. In addition to weight loss and increased strength, Fit By Design has also helped clients overcome health issues such as herniated disks. Clients praise the business for its supportive and caring environment, making it an excellent choice for those seeking a personalized and effective fitness experience.

    I can’t say enough about Kris and the transformation I’ve experienced!

    When I started, I was limping from knee pain, felt like I was 20 years older than I am, and was losing sleep when just rolling over in bed caused enough knee pain to wake me up!

    Last week I went for a 12 mile run in prep for a 100k ultramarathon in October, and I got my first 14er the next day at Mount Elbert in Colorado. Back to back days, 24 miles, over 6000’ of vertical. Knee pain? ZERO! I am ecstatic!

    I’m excited to see what I’m capable of now that my movement patterns support my joint health rather than doing damage.
